Is 70% dark chocolate healthy?

Of course, the darker the chocolate the better, but any 70 percent dark chocolate or higher contains antioxidants, fiber, potassium, calcium, copper, and magnesium, according to an overview published in December 2019 in the International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.

What are the benefits of eating 70% dark chocolate?

Dark chocolate is packed full of important minerals, including iron, magnesium, zinc, copper and phosphorus. In your body, these minerals are used to support factors such as immunity (zinc), can help keep your bones and teeth healthy (phosphorus), and contribute to better sleep quality (magnesium).

What does 70% cocoa mean?

Cocoa butter is the edible fat extracted from the cocoa bean, and has its own cocoa aroma and flavour. So a dark chocolate bar with a cocoa content of 70%, means that 70% of the chocolate has been made from ingredients found purely in the cocoa bean.

Can dark chocolate make you fat?

Dark chocolate is high in calories and fat, which may contribute to weight gain if consumed in excess. Some types also contain high amounts of added sugar, which can increase the calorie count and contribute to chronic disease.

Is dark chocolate healthier than spinach?

Both bittersweet chocolate and spinach are high in dietary fiber. Bittersweet chocolate has 655% more dietary fiber than spinach - bittersweet chocolate has 16.6g of dietary fiber per 100 grams and spinach has 2.2g of dietary fiber.

Is all dark chocolate healthy?

Although dark chocolate contains beneficial antioxidants and minerals, it is usually also high in sugar and fat, which makes it a very calorie-dense food. Dark chocolate contains fat in the form of cocoa butter, which mainly consists of unhealthful saturated fats.

How much dark chocolate should I eat a day?

What is the daily recommended amount of dark chocolate? The recommended “dose” is approximately 1 to 2 ounces or 30-60g, experts say. Indulge in anything more than that, and you may be consuming too many calories. A 1.45-ounce (41 gram) Hershey's Special Dark Chocolate Bar has 190 calories.
